  • Publication number: 20220285985
    Abstract: A contactless power supply device includes a handle attachable and detachable with respect to a main body case at least partially covering a main body part including an electric unit, a power transmission module to be provided to protrude from the main body case, and having a power transmission coil electrified based on power supplied to the main body part, a power reception module housed in the handle to face the power transmission module when the handle is fixed to the main body case, and having a power reception coil contactlessly supplied with power via the power transmission coil, and a detection unit provided in the handle, driven based on the power supplied via the power reception module, and configured to detect whether the handle is being gripped.
    Type: Application
    Filed: January 28, 2022
    Publication date: September 8, 2022
    Inventors: Eiji SATO, Takayuki Nagata, Fumio Ohta
  • Patent number: 10447081
    Abstract: There is provided a secondary coil module receiving supply of electric power via a primary coil by contactless power transfer technique. The secondary coil module includes a core formed of magnetic material, the core having a tubular portion in the form of a tube and a bottom portion formed integral with the tubular portion in such a manner as to close an opening of the tubular portion formed at one axial end portion thereof, a storage battery accommodated within an accommodation space provided inside the tubular portion and configured to be charged by the power via the primary coil and a coil winding disposed outside the core and on the side of the bottom portion of the core.
    Type: Grant
    Filed: March 2, 2016
    Date of Patent: October 15, 2019
    Assignee: Hosiden Corporation
    Inventors: Hiroshi Ema, Fumio Ohta, Eiji Sato
  • Patent number: 10030886
    Abstract: In an outdoor unit of a refrigeration apparatus is a blow-out opening configured to deliver air from an air-blowing fan that is covered by a protective grill. The outdoor unit includes an eave part protruding in a direction along which the air is blown out from a top part of the grill. A top surface of the eave part has a water-leading part extending in a direction intersecting the direction along which the air is blown out. The water-leading part leads water dripping down onto the top surface of the eave part to at least one of longitudinal ends of the eave part and a middle of the eave part.
    Type: Grant
    Filed: October 22, 2012
    Date of Patent: July 24, 2018
    Assignee: Daikin Industries, Ltd.
    Inventors: Shunya Iino, Kazuyoshi Taguchi, Fumio Ohta, Minoru Nishikawa

  • Publication number: 20150015079
    Abstract: A noncontact power supply system includes a power supply device having a primary coil acting as an electromagnetic induction coil for a noncontact power supply system, and a power receiving device having a secondary coil. The primary coil has a primary core and a winding wire. The secondary coil has a secondary core and a winding wire. The primary core includes a base segment, a pair of extension segments, and a pair of opposite segments. The pair of opposite segments are arranged to allow a space to be defined therebetween. The winding wire is wound at least around the pair of opposite segments. The secondary coil is arranged between the pair of opposite segments during power supply. The power receiving device includes a magnetic sheet that is in tight contact with an end surface of the secondary core and has an area larger than that of the end surface.
    Type: Application
    Filed: July 9, 2014
    Publication date: January 15, 2015
    Inventors: Fumio Ohta, Hiroshi Ema, Eiji Sato

  • Patent number: 8445536
    Abstract: A composition for increasing blood flow is provided, wherein side effects such as lowering of blood pressure are reduced and blood flow is effectively increased in the capillaries. A composition containing arginine in an amount from 25 mg/kg body weight to 150 mg/kg body weight is also provided. A food composition or a feeding stuff containing the composition is also provided. Method of using the above compositions to increase blood flow is also provided.
    Type: Grant
    Filed: March 30, 2006
    Date of Patent: May 21, 2013
    Assignee: Ajinomoto Co., Inc.
    Inventors: Fumio Ohta, Tomo Takagi, Hiroyuki Sato
